pigmentation
• around 4 to 7 months of age, mice develop dark patches in the dorsal brown coat
• with age these patches spread to fill almost all of the dorsal coat but the color of the ventral coat does not change
• patches eventually turn grey
• treatment with N-acetyl cysteine for 60 days failed to prevent the color change
